The bacterium Helicobacter pylori is one of the most common causes of ulcers. It can inhabit the mucus layer that lines and protects the stomach.
When bacteria levels get out of balance, H. pylori can multiply and disrupt the mucus layer, producing an ulcer. H. pylori and bacterial outbreaks in the stomach can also lead to inflammation and eroding of the stomach lining.

Deglycyrrhizinated Licorice
Deglycyrrhizinated licorice (DGL) is a specially-processed form of licorice root that contains higher amounts of active constituents that soothe mucous membranes of the upper digestive tract. These active compounds also inhibit enzymes involved in the production of proinflammatory signaling molecules. And, DGL is safer for long-term use with less potential for interactions with medications or medical conditions than regular licorice root.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M) has relied on licorice root for thousands of years to maintain digestive system health, promote vitality, and support liver function. Modern research has confirmed that licorice root can promote healing of the stomach lining and supports a healthy inflammatory response. Licorice root also provides potent antioxidant activity.
Cloves
Cloves are the tiny flower buds of the clove tree, a tropical evergreen tree native to Indonesia, Madagascar and Tanzania. Cloves have a history of traditional use and are linked with oral and digestive health. Cloves are said to promote healthy digestion and assimilation of dietary nutrients. Cloves may also enhance the production of gastric mucus, which functions as a barrier and helps prevent damage to the stomach lining by digestive acids. Plus, cloves may help protect the liver. Cloves are rich in antioxidants and have been shown to stimulate immune function to inhibit the growth of unfavorable microbes in the gastrointestinal tract.
Elecampane
Elecampane was used by ancient Greeks and Romans for a number of health problems, including digestive and respiratory concerns. Hippocrates advocated it for the kidneys, brain, uterus and stomach. Roman author, naturalist and military commander Pliny said that eating elecampane daily would “help digestion and cause mirth.” When taken as a dietary supplement, elecampane may help soothe gastrointestinal issues and combat foreign organisms. Elecampane also supports a healthy inflammatory response.
Pau D’Arco
According to records, Pau d’arco was used by the Incas, Kallawayas and other native South American groups for its many healing properties. They called it taheebo or lapacho. Pau d'arco's active components, including lapachol and beta-lapachone, stimulate immune function and promote a healthy microbiome by combating unfriendly microbes. Research indicates that pau d’arco seems to help prevent microbes from getting the oxygen and energy they need to thrive. Plus, pau d'arco contains significant amounts of quercetin, a powerful antioxidant.
Capsicum
Capsicum, also commonly known as cayenne or chili powder, is one of the hottest spices. Known for its warming strength, capsicum stimulates digestion and enhances blood flow, thus promoting healthy circulation of the blood. In traditional herbal medicine, capsicum has been used throughout the ages for a variety of health concerns, including intestinal parasites, tissue healing, poor appetite, and sluggish digestion, to name a few. Capsicum also provides antioxidant and immune system benefits. Capsicum is added to many herbal formulas as an effective catalyst to help the body transport and use the companion ingredients.
